34 /* Entropy constrained matrix-weighted VQ, hard-coded to 5-element vectors, for a single input data vector */
35 void silk_VQ_WMat_EC_c(
36 opus_int8 *ind, /* O index of best codebook vector */
37 opus_int32 *rate_dist_Q14, /* O best wei ghted quant error + mu * rate */
38 opus_int *gain_Q7, /* O sum of a bsolute LTP coefficients */
39 const opus_int16 *in_Q14, /* I input ve ctor to be quantized */
40 const opus_int32 *W_Q18, /* I weightin g matrix */
41 const opus_int8 *cb_Q7, /* I codebook */
42 const opus_uint8 *cb_gain_Q7, /* I codebook effective gain */
43 const opus_uint8 *cl_Q5, /* I code len gth for each codebook vector */
44 const opus_int mu_Q9, /* I tradeoff betw. weighted error and rate */
45 const opus_int32 max_gain_Q7, /* I maximum sum of absolute LTP coefficients */
46 opus_int L /* I number o f vectors in codebook */
47 )
48 {
49 opus_int k, gain_tmp_Q7;
50 const opus_int8 *cb_row_Q7;
51 opus_int16 diff_Q14[ 5 ];
52 opus_int32 sum1_Q14, sum2_Q16;
53
54 /* Loop over codebook */
55 *rate_dist_Q14 = silk_int32_MAX;
56 cb_row_Q7 = cb_Q7;
57 for( k = 0; k < L; k++ ) {
58 gain_tmp_Q7 = cb_gain_Q7[k];
59
60 diff_Q14[ 0 ] = in_Q14[ 0 ] - silk_LSHIFT( cb_row_Q7[ 0 ], 7 );
61 diff_Q14[ 1 ] = in_Q14[ 1 ] - silk_LSHIFT( cb_row_Q7[ 1 ], 7 );
62 diff_Q14[ 2 ] = in_Q14[ 2 ] - silk_LSHIFT( cb_row_Q7[ 2 ], 7 );
63 diff_Q14[ 3 ] = in_Q14[ 3 ] - silk_LSHIFT( cb_row_Q7[ 3 ], 7 );
64 diff_Q14[ 4 ] = in_Q14[ 4 ] - silk_LSHIFT( cb_row_Q7[ 4 ], 7 );
65
66 /* Weighted rate */
67 sum1_Q14 = silk_SMULBB( mu_Q9, cl_Q5[ k ] );
68
69 /* Penalty for too large gain */
70 sum1_Q14 = silk_ADD_LSHIFT32( sum1_Q14, silk_max( silk_SUB32( gain_tmp_Q 7, max_gain_Q7 ), 0 ), 10 );
71
72 silk_assert( sum1_Q14 >= 0 );
73
74 /* first row of W_Q18 */
75 sum2_Q16 = silk_SMULWB( W_Q18[ 1 ], diff_Q14[ 1 ] );
76 sum2_Q16 = silk_SMLAWB( sum2_Q16, W_Q18[ 2 ], diff_Q14[ 2 ] );
77 sum2_Q16 = silk_SMLAWB( sum2_Q16, W_Q18[ 3 ], diff_Q14[ 3 ] );
78 sum2_Q16 = silk_SMLAWB( sum2_Q16, W_Q18[ 4 ], diff_Q14[ 4 ] );
79 sum2_Q16 = silk_LSHIFT( sum2_Q16, 1 );
80 sum2_Q16 = silk_SMLAWB( sum2_Q16, W_Q18[ 0 ], diff_Q14[ 0 ] );
81 sum1_Q14 = silk_SMLAWB( sum1_Q14, sum2_Q16, diff_Q14[ 0 ] );
82
83 /* second row of W_Q18 */
84 sum2_Q16 = silk_SMULWB( W_Q18[ 7 ], diff_Q14[ 2 ] );
85 sum2_Q16 = silk_SMLAWB( sum2_Q16, W_Q18[ 8 ], diff_Q14[ 3 ] );
86 sum2_Q16 = silk_SMLAWB( sum2_Q16, W_Q18[ 9 ], diff_Q14[ 4 ] );
87 sum2_Q16 = silk_LSHIFT( sum2_Q16, 1 );
88 sum2_Q16 = silk_SMLAWB( sum2_Q16, W_Q18[ 6 ], diff_Q14[ 1 ] );
89 sum1_Q14 = silk_SMLAWB( sum1_Q14, sum2_Q16, diff_Q14[ 1 ] );
90
91 /* third row of W_Q18 */
92 sum2_Q16 = silk_SMULWB( W_Q18[ 13 ], diff_Q14[ 3 ] );
93 sum2_Q16 = silk_SMLAWB( sum2_Q16, W_Q18[ 14 ], diff_Q14[ 4 ] );
94 sum2_Q16 = silk_LSHIFT( sum2_Q16, 1 );
95 sum2_Q16 = silk_SMLAWB( sum2_Q16, W_Q18[ 12 ], diff_Q14[ 2 ] );
96 sum1_Q14 = silk_SMLAWB( sum1_Q14, sum2_Q16, diff_Q14[ 2 ] );
97
98 /* fourth row of W_Q18 */
99 sum2_Q16 = silk_SMULWB( W_Q18[ 19 ], diff_Q14[ 4 ] );
100 sum2_Q16 = silk_LSHIFT( sum2_Q16, 1 );
101 sum2_Q16 = silk_SMLAWB( sum2_Q16, W_Q18[ 18 ], diff_Q14[ 3 ] );
102 sum1_Q14 = silk_SMLAWB( sum1_Q14, sum2_Q16, diff_Q14[ 3 ] );
103
104 /* last row of W_Q18 */
105 sum2_Q16 = silk_SMULWB( W_Q18[ 24 ], diff_Q14[ 4 ] );
106 sum1_Q14 = silk_SMLAWB( sum1_Q14, sum2_Q16, diff_Q14[ 4 ] );
107
108 silk_assert( sum1_Q14 >= 0 );
109
110 /* find best */
111 if( sum1_Q14 < *rate_dist_Q14 ) {
112 *rate_dist_Q14 = sum1_Q14;
113 *ind = (opus_int8)k;
114 *gain_Q7 = gain_tmp_Q7;
115 }
116
117 /* Go to next cbk vector */
118 cb_row_Q7 += LTP_ORDER;
119 }
120 }
